Synopsis

The Shiniest Star heads a large cast in this original version of the Nativity story.

This musical score shows melody, lyrics and guitar chords.

Ideal for 4-7-year olds, this production was created by music theatre professionals with extensive experience in running children's theatre workshops.

It features an easy-to-follow business/fundraising plan describing the responsibilities of each member of the backstage/production team.

There is an easy-to-use checklist for the cast with character descriptions, musical numbers for easy rehearsal scheduling, costume fuss-free suggestions, props, percussion suggestions and a final pre-show checklist.

Ideas for simple staging, scenery, lighting and choreography are included.

A CD with backing tracks (instrumentals only) and performance tracks (with vocals) is included also!
